Wells Branch
Wells Branch Extension Homemakers are one of 4 local community groups that comprise York County Extension Homemakers. We have 20 members and meet on the first Tuesday of every month at the Wells Congregational Church on Route 1 in Wells.

Information was shared for the Maine Mitten Project. This is a statewide effort where volunteers knit mittens, hats, and scarves to support four agencies. Visit their website for information.
